Interesting thoughts from different sides but just like forcasting today they can get it very wrong.The truth is that the weather in early June 1944 was as bad as it can get and personally i think Eisenhower wasnt the sort of man to keep waiting around so decided to go anyway and despite the forcast to be much calmer i dont think it actually was,many of those soldiers drowned before getting to shore especially the floating tanks,they are all on the seabed with the soldiers still in.It is a little puzzling however that they didnt wait for calmer conditions as it wouldnt have made much difference to either attack of defend.We are all made aware that we could have been beat on the beaches but in reality the Germans thought we would land close to Calais and Normandy was very thinly defended as was the entire Western front except for the Calais area.As for the war being won in the West on that day that simply wasnt the case,the Germans were already beaten.There were 34 divisions facing Western allies and 187 divisions facing the Russians,such was the fear of the Russians the Germans sent no extra forces from the East to face the West.

BlueSkies_do_I_see In March 1965 25 degrees was recorded on the 29th March,this i believe is the outright March maximum recorded at Whitby which was amazingly the hottest day in Whitby for the whole year.Just as amazing is that on the 3rd day of that month Corwen in Wales recorded -21.7 deg,the coldest day of the year for the whole country,anamazingly cold temperature for March,only 2 winters have recorded lower in almost 30 years!
